c语言main函数中除了后main函数外,其他函数能作为单独文件形式存在吗?

一般程序中都是认为c语言main函数程序在运行过程中是由Main函数开始,最后到Main函数结束

实际上,在可执行文件被加载之后控制权立即交给由编译器插入的Start函数,它将对后媔这些全局变量进行准备:

_osver 操作系统的构件编号

_winmajor 操作系统的主版本号_winminor 操作系统的次版本号_winver 操作系统完全版本号

_argc 命令行参数个数

_argv 指向参数字符串的指针数组

_environ 指向环境变量字符串的指针数组

在C99标准中main的定义方式只有一下两种是正确的:

argc 是表示参数个数(可执行文件名也是一个参数);

argv是表示输入命令行时由系统接收实际参数的个数自动复制的;

拍照搜题秒出答案,一键查看所有搜题记录

拍照搜题秒出答案,一键查看所有搜题记录

我要回帖

更多关于 c语言main函数 的文章

 

随机推荐